STORYLINE:
35-year-old Zhang Yongxin heads a charity service center in Guiyang, China.
The center runs several restaurants offering free lunches every day at noon for elderly residents, especially those who are very old, disabled, or facing financial difficulties.
SOUNDBITE 1 (Chinese): ZHANG YONGXIN, Head of the Elderly Assistance Charity Service Center in Guiyang
"I joined this charity organization for elderly assistance in November 2017. After volunteering for a while, I saw that the platform, the organization needed young people to help out more. So I decided to join full-time."
The community charity restaurants explore mutual support services for aging in place, with younger seniors helping older seniors.
Senior volunteers handle the cooking, cleaning, and dishwashing. Some volunteers have even transitioned from diners to volunteers.
SOUNDBITE 2 (Chinese): ZHANG YONGXIN, Head of the Elderly Assistance Charity Service Center in Guiyang
"This is the head chef at the service center in our district. She joined us in 2017 and became the head chef in 2019."
SOUNDBITE 3 (Chinese): XIE DEXIANG, Volunteer
"I feel that serving these elderly people is a meaningful part of my life, and I quite enjoy working here."
SOUNDBITE 4 (Chinese): CHENG JUNBEN, Volunteer
"I mainly wanted to contribute more to the society, and I've been doing this from my 70s into my 80s."
SOUNDBITE 5 (Chinese): ZHANG YONGXIN, Head of the Elderly Assistance Charity Service Center in Guiyang
"This is Grandma Liao. A diner before, a volunteer now."
SOUNDBITE 6 (Chinese): LIAO GUIXIANG, Volunteer
"Being with everyone here makes me very happy. Serving others makes me feel that I'm achieving something for others as well as for myself. When I come to the center, I feel relaxed and healthier overall compared to staying at home. And I also feel much more cheerful."
SOUNDBITE 7 (Chinese): ZHANG YONGXIN, Head of the Elderly Assistance Charity Service Center in Guiyang
"Besides providing meals at our service center, we also deliver food to elderly individuals who have mobility issues or severe illnesses and cannot cook for themselves. If we encounter particularly needy seniors, such as those whose children are not close by, we'll deliver extra meals to their homes."
SOUNDBITE 8 (Chinese): ZHANG YONGXIN, Head of the Elderly Assistance Charity Service Center in Guiyang
"Today, we're serving fried rice with carrots, mushrooms, and vegetables. You can take your time eating it."
Since 2014, the elderly assistance charity service center in Guiyang has served about 2 million meals over 3,000 days.
SOUNDBITE 9 (Chinese): ZHANG YONGXIN, Head of the Elderly Assistance Charity Service Center in Guiyang
"At first, our goal was simply to provide the elderly with a hot, healthy, and nutritious lunch. But we soon realized that the elderly who came for the meals needed more than just food -- they needed care and companionship. They need a platform and space for social interaction, entertainment, and activities. So, we decided to transform the meal into a bridge, using it to bring the elderly together. We want them to engage in various activities suited to their age, support each other, exchange greetings, and show mutual care and concern. This way, they can find spiritual enrichment and enjoy a happier, more fulfilling later life."
